Currency Conversion: The Exchange Rate Factor

Here's where math meets reality. You need to convert CNY to your local currency. The exchange rate varies constantly, but as of recent trends, 1 USD typically equals approximately 7.2-7.3 CNY. However, CNFans and payment processors don't give you the exact bank rate—they add a small markup.

For example, if those Represent jeans are ¥280: At 7.2 rate = $38.89 USD, but with processing markup, expect closer to $40-41. Always add 2-3% to the official exchange rate for realistic calculations. This might seem small, but on multiple items, it adds up!

Domestic Shipping: Getting Jeans to the Warehouse

This is often overlooked but crucial! Domestic shipping is the cost to get your premium denim from the seller to the CNFans warehouse in China. For jeans, this typically ranges from ¥8-15 ($1.10-$2.10 USD) depending on the seller's location.

Most spreadsheet sellers include free domestic shipping, but ALWAYS verify this. Some premium denim sellers charge separately, especially if they're shipping heavyweight selvedge denim or multiple pairs. Check the spreadsheet notes or ask your agent to confirm before purchasing.

The Weight Factor: Why Denim Costs More to Ship

Here's something that makes premium denim unique in the CNFans world—jeans are HEAVY! A single pair of quality denim typically weighs 500-800 grams, and heavyweight selvedge or embellished designer jeans (looking at you, Amiri crystal jeans) can hit 900-1200 grams.

International shipping is calculated by weight, usually per 500g. If you're shipping via popular routes: EMS typically charges $25-30 for the first kg, then $8-10 per additional 500g. SAL/Sea shipping is cheaper at $15-20 for first kg, $5-7 per 500g, but takes 30-60 days. Express lines (FedEx/DHL) run $35-45 for first kg, $12-15 per 500g.

The Complete Calculation Formula

Ready for the magic formula? Here it is: TOTAL COST = (Base Price CNY + Domestic Shipping CNY) × Exchange Rate + International Shipping + Optional Services + Payment Processing Fee (usually 3-4%)

Let's run a real example with Represent Destroyer Jeans: Base price: ¥280, Domestic shipping: ¥10 (included), Subtotal: ¥290, Convert to USD (at 7.3 rate): $39.73, International shipping (600g via SAL): $18, QC extra photos: $0.85, Reinforced packaging: $2.80, Payment processing (4%): $2.45, GRAND TOTAL: $63.83

Compare that to the $250-300 retail price—you're saving over $185! But you knew the REAL cost upfront, which is empowering.

Volume Discounts and Multi-Pair Strategy

Here's where it gets exciting for denim enthusiasts! Shipping multiple pairs together dramatically reduces per-item cost. The first kg is always the most expensive, so adding a second or third pair of jeans only adds the incremental weight cost.

Example: One pair (700g) via EMS: $28 shipping = $28 per pair. Three pairs (2100g) via EMS: $28 + $16 + $8 = $52 total = $17.33 per pair. You save over $10 per pair just by bundling! This is why serious denim collectors plan hauls strategically.

Hidden Costs to Watch For

Some costs catch buyers off-guard: Storage fees if items sit in the warehouse beyond 90-180 days (usually free initially, then ¥1-2 per day), Return shipping if you reject items after QC (¥15-30 depending on seller), Customs duties in your country (varies widely—US has $800 exemption, EU around €150, UK £135), Package insurance (optional, usually 2-3% of declared value).
